Evidence suggests that musical arts are central to learning and are in fact, the driving force behind all other learning. The non-academic benefits are also crucial to a student’s well being. Music is widely known to support relaxation, creativity, self discipline and motivation.

In Music Class students learn to read music, study composers and listen to their music. They analyze music, and express themselves through singing, playing instruments and moving/dancing to music.
